BURJAN Gabor wrote:
>
> Hello,
>
> I have a problem with booting 2.4.17-rc1 on a RS/6000 (43P-140), when
> Vortex support is compiled into the kernel.
>
> ...
>
> >>NIP; c0264050 <vortex_probe1+394/cbc> <=====
> Trace; c0263f28 <vortex_probe1+26c/cbc>
That's a big function, unfortunately. Could you please
do the following?
In the top-level makefile, add the line:
CFLAGS += -g
right at the end. Then rebuild the kernel, recreate the
crash, then run:
gdb vmlinux
(gdb) l *0xc0264050
(Assuming that this is still the NIP address after you've rebuilt).
This should point us at the source code where the problem is
occurring.
